We talk to a man who survived one of the worst nuclear accidents.
Imagine a nuclear bomb more powerful than Hiroshima hitting Arkansas and wiping ten million people off the face of the Earth. It almost happened! One of the most frightening stories you've likely never heard from a man who lived to tell it.
